Maputo

Japan has pledged 88,400 US dollars to finance the construction of a health post at Ambrosio, in Boane district, about 30 kilometres west of Maputo.

An agreement on this grant was signed in Maputo on Friday between Domingos Cossa, executive director of the Mozambican NGO, FUCON ("Futuro conjunto" - Joint Future) and Japanese ambassador Tatsuya Miki.

The new health unit will include a maternity unit, a pharmacy, and a house for the nurse. The ambassador said at the signing ceremony that preliminary research showed that the health post will benefit 5,000 people directly and 15,000 indirectly.

"We are sure that this project will help reduce the suffering of people who travel long distances in search of medical care, and will be a fundamental step in consolidating relations between the Japanese and Mozambican peoples", claimed Miki.

Cossa said that the Ambrosio health post will deal with questions of mother and child care and malaria treatment. It will also complement efforts undertaken by HIV/AIDS activists and mobile HIV testing units in Boane and the nearby districts of Namaacha and Catembe.

The Japanese programme to support community projects has funded four health projects in Mozambique since 2001, to a total amount of 204,150 dollars.
